Crepes are soft, thin, and delicate French-style pancakes typically served for breakfast or dessert. So, what's in a basic crepe recipe? These overnight oats are enticing enough to get even a late riseršŸ˜‰out of bed. What is Overnight Oats? Overnight oatmeal is a make-ahead breakfast option that is prepared the night before, giving you an instant healthy breakfast the next morning. It is easy to prepare(no cooking involved!) and perfect for those hectic mornings when you don't have the time to make breakfast. To make overnight oats, we need to soak rolled oats in milk and yogurt overnight that gives it the soft, creamy texture. In the morning, you can add your favorite toppings-fresh fruits and nuts and your healthy, satisfying breakfast is ready to rock.
